Tatworth Memorial Hall (T.M.H.)

Tatworth Memorial Hall will meet all your social and business needs (see "Coming Events" for activities in the hall). It offers flexible accommodation for group large and small and is the ideal venue for meetings, training sessions, parties, film shows. dancing and concerts.
The Hall opened in 1953 and was extended and refurbished in 2001 with the help from the National Lottery. It is a registered charity and is managed by a committee of volunteers who are the trustees. The Hall has been awarded Hallmark 2 by the Community Council for Somerset in recognition of the quality of its management. It receives no public money and is entirely dependent on hire charges and fund raising activities. For hire charges please see the bottom of this page.

THE MAIN HALL
The Hall is proud of its original wooden floor, large curtained stage with high quality lighting, sound system and drop down screen. A good quality piano is available.
The Hall can accommodate up to 140 people for a meeting or a performance. The Hall has a premises licence for the sale of alcohol and is also licensed by the Performing Rights Society
THE COZENS' ROOM
This room adjoins the Hall and has a bar. It may also be used as a small meeting room.
THE KITCHEN
The kitchen is well equipped with cooker, fridge, and microwave. there is ample crockery, cutlery and glassware.
HOSKINS' ANNEXE (built in 2001)
THE BREWER ROOM
provides smaller (8.4 x 4.5 metres) self contained accommodation for meetings and functions. It is comfortably carpeted and furnished with good lighting and facilities for preparing refreshments. It will accommodate up to 40 in close seating.
THE STONHAM ROOM provides another smaller room ( 7.4 x 4.5 metres) two thirds is carpeted and the remainder has a washable floor and can be furnished with an adjustable medical couch, examination chair and light and a small trolley. There are two sinks, a range of units, good lighting and facilities for preparing refreshments. (Photos. on Health & Wellbeing page.)

The Hallmark Achievement Award for Village and Community Halls
Awarded by The Community Council for Somerset.
Hallmark Awards are for village and community halls in Somerset. The awards assess the sterling worth of halls and their committees throughout the county, recognising and improving levels of achievement against an agreed standard.
The Award has three levels:
Hallmark 1 focuses on the management and administration of the charity.
Hallmark 2 focuses on health, safety, security and licenses
Hallmark 3 focuses on communication with the community, with users and within the committee. Also included in this award are general social awareness, forward planning and development.
